LL.M. in Sports Administration and Technology

objective
Broaden knowledge in sports management
Help achieve a stronger skill set for the existing or desired career in the sport industry
Blend scientific knowledge with real world understanding to prepare participants for a successful career as future leaders in modern sport
audience
Sports-minded professional wishing to broaden his/her knowledge in sports administration, and to achieve a stronger skill set for the existing or desired career in the sports industry. The candidate must be fluent in English, have an undergraduate degree, and a master’s degree and/or work experience. Participants come from all over the world and from various academic and professionnal backgrounds, but they all share one goal: to play a key role in the future of the sports industry
programme
A unique interdisciplinary programme applied directly to sport in the fields of Management & Economics, Technology, Law, Sociology and Medicine. Includes: lectures, case studies, activities, field trips, completion of work experience in the sports industry, presentation of a team project, and submission of a research paper•
